Gate Repair Maintenance Checklist for Burbank Homeowners

Most gate maintenance checklists tell you to “lubricate the chain.” They don’t tell you that a chain with more than 3% elongation will strip the drive sprocket within 60 days regardless of how much lubricant you apply. That’s the difference between a checklist that prevents failures and a checklist that just makes you feel responsible. This guide gives Burbank homeowners the actual measurements, observable conditions, and pass/fail thresholds that separate normal wear from an impending gate failure. If you own a driveway gate in Burbank, you’ll learn what to check, what the numbers mean, and when to pick up the phone before a $60 adjustment becomes a $1,800 motor replacement.

Quick Answer

A useful Burbank gate maintenance checklist measures specific thresholds: chain elongation under 3%, hinge play under 2mm of lateral movement, battery float voltage between 13.2V and 13.8V, and photo-eye alignment within a 1-inch visual tolerance at 20 feet. Homeowners can safely perform lubrication, visual inspection, and photo logging every 90 days; anything involving limit switches, capacitor discharge, or hydraulic fluid requires a licensed technician under California electrical code.

The Monthly Visual Inspection: What Actually Matters

A monthly walk-around takes about 10 minutes and catches roughly 80% of gate failures before they strand you in your driveway or, worse, leave your property unsecured overnight. The key is knowing what to look at and what a problem actually looks like. We’ve repaired gates in Burbank where the homeowner noticed a “weird sound” three weeks before the motor burned out but didn’t know the sound meant a failing capacitor. Here’s what to look for, in order of importance.

Track and wheel condition: Run your hand along the track (when the gate is closed and the power is off). You’re feeling for rough spots, pitting, or debris buildup. A v-groove wheel that’s worn flat will cause the gate to drag, which overworks the motor. Look for metal shavings on the track. That’s not normal wear; that’s active grinding.

Gate position at rest: A gate that has drifted from vertical by more than 5 degrees is telling you something: a hinge, a wheel, or the post itself has moved. In Burbank’s clay-heavy soil, posts settle unevenly after rain seasons. A 5-degree lean compounds stress on every other component.

Fastener tightness: With the gate closed and power off, try to wiggle each hinge bolt by hand. If you can move any bolt with finger pressure, it’s loose. A single loose hinge bolt transfers load to the remaining bolts, which then fatigue and shear. This is a 2-minute check that prevents the most common catastrophic gate failure we see: a gate dropping off its hinges onto a car or a person.

Debris in the path: Burbank’s mature trees drop leaves, jacaranda flowers, and palm fronds into gate tracks year-round. Organic debris holds moisture, accelerates rust, and can wedge between the gate and the end stop, causing the motor to stall repeatedly. Each stall overheats the motor windings slightly. Twenty stalls is enough to degrade motor insulation. Clear debris with a stiff brush, not a pressure washer.

Start with this walk-around. If everything passes, move to measurements. That’s where the real maintenance happens.

Chain and Belt Measurements: The 3% Elongation Rule

Here’s the problem with “check the chain” as maintenance advice: you can’t tell by looking whether a chain is worn. A worn chain looks almost identical to a new chain. The wear is in the pins and bushings, not the visible plates. The only way to check a chain is to measure it, and the number that matters is 3% elongation.

How to measure chain elongation at home:

  1. Close the gate. Disconnect power at the breaker or unplug the operator.
  2. Wrap a cloth tape measure around the chain at its longest accessible run and pull it taut. Note the distance between, say, 10 links.
  3. Compare that distance to the chain’s specification. A standard #40 or #50 chain has a pitch of 0.5 inches or 0.625 inches per link respectively. Ten links of #40 chain should measure exactly 5.0 inches when new.
  4. If your 10-link measurement is 5.15 inches or more, that’s 3% elongation. The chain is done.

Why 3%? Because chain and sprocket wear is a feedback loop. As the chain elongates, the pitch no longer matches the sprocket tooth spacing. The rollers start climbing the teeth. That concentrates load on fewer teeth, which wears the sprocket faster, which accelerates chain wear. Below 3%, you can replace just the chain. Above 3%, you almost always need to replace the chain and the sprockets together, because the sprocket tooth profile has already been deformed.

For belt-drive gates, the measurement is different but the principle is identical. A belt that’s glazed (smooth and shiny on the contact surface) has lost its grip. A belt with visible cracking at the tooth root is close to snapping. Belts don’t elongate like chains; they fail suddenly. If your gate uses a belt drive and you can’t read the belt’s part number because of wear, that’s your cue to replace it.

Most Burbank homes with chain-drive slide gates use LiftMaster or BFT operators. The chain on a typical 16-foot slide gate needs replacement every 5 to 7 years with normal use. If you’re on a busy street like Glenoaks or Olive Avenue with frequent gate cycles, expect 3 to 4 years.

Hinge Play: Measuring Wear in Millimeters, Not Vibes

Hinge wear is the slowest-moving failure on a gate, and the hardest to notice without a measurement. Here’s the pass/fail threshold we use on every service call: with the gate closed, lift the gate leaf at the latch end. If you measure more than 2mm of vertical movement, the hinge pins or bushings are worn beyond acceptable limits.

How to measure it: Tape a piece of paper to the gate post at the latch end. Draw a horizontal line at the top edge of the gate when it’s at rest. Lift the gate with one hand and mark the new top edge position. Measure the gap between the two lines. That’s your hinge play. Do this for both gate leaves on a double swing gate.

Two millimeters doesn’t sound like much. But hinge play multiplies at the latch end. The latch end is typically 6 to 8 feet from the hinge post. A 2mm play at the hinge translates to visible sag at the latch end. That sag makes the latch misalign, then the latch bolt drags, then the operator fights the drag, then the motor overheats. Hinge wear is the root cause behind a surprisingly large share of the gate motor and opener repairs in Burbank that come through our shop.

Hinges on Burbank gates wear faster than average because of the wind. Santa Ana events, especially the sustained 40-mph gusts we get in the fall, cycle the gate at its hinge points continuously. It’s not a big force, but it’s applied for hours. Over a season, that’s hundreds of thousands of micro-cycles. Hinges with grease fittings should be greased every 90 days. Hinges without fittings are sealed units; replace them when they exceed 2mm of play, don’t try to drill and add a fitting.

Battery and Electrical Basics: Float Voltage and What It Tells You

Battery backup systems are standard on most Burbank gate operators, especially on hillside and canyon properties where power outages are more frequent. The battery is also the component homeowners understand least. Here’s the number that matters: float voltage.

A healthy 12V lead-acid battery in a gate operator should read between 13.2V and 13.8V when the charger is in float mode with the gate at rest. Below 13.0V means the charger isn’t maintaining the battery. Below 12.4V means the battery is being discharged and not recovering. Below 11.8V under load means the battery is effectively dead and will not open the gate during a power outage.

How to check it: A $25 digital multimeter set to DC volts. Touch the probes to the battery terminals with the operator powered. Note the reading with the gate at rest, then again while the gate is opening (have someone press the button). If the resting voltage is good but the opening voltage drops below 11.5V, the battery has internal resistance and needs replacement.

Warning: anything beyond checking battery voltage with a multimeter crosses into dangerous territory. Gate operators contain capacitors that store a lethal charge even after the unit is unplugged. A capacitor in a BFT or Viking operator can hold hundreds of volts. Do not open the operator housing. Do not touch the control board. Do not attempt to discharge anything. We’ve stated this explicitly in our gate repair guide for Burbank, and it bears repeating here: electrical work on gate operators is licensed-technician territory under California electrical code.

Battery replacement schedules in Burbank run about 3 years on average. Heat kills lead-acid batteries faster than anything else, and Burbank summers with weeks above 90°F accelerate the chemical degradation. If your battery is older than 3 years and you live on a property where the operator is in direct afternoon sun, preemptively replace it. The cost of a battery is trivial compared to the cost of a gate that won’t open during a PSPS event.

Photo-Eye Alignment: The Infrared Beam That Prevents Crush Injuries

The photo-eye, called a photo-eye or safety beam, is the pair of small boxes mounted near the bottom of the gate opening on opposite sides. One emits an infrared beam. The other receives it. If anything breaks the beam while the gate is closing, the operator reverses immediately. This is not optional equipment. It’s mandated by UL 325, the safety standard for automatic gate operators, and it prevents the most severe gate injuries.

Photo-eye misalignment is the single most common cause of “my gate won’t close” service calls we see in Burbank. Here’s the pass/fail test:

Alignment check: With the gate fully open and the path clear, look at the receiver photo-eye. Most units have a small LED that’s solid when the beam is aligned and blinking when it’s not. If it’s blinking, the beam is broken or the eyes are out of alignment. Bump the emitter slightly and watch the receiver LED. Solid means aligned.

The 1-inch rule: Photo-eyes are forgiving. They work if the beam hits the receiver lens within its active area, which is typically about 1 inch in diameter. If you can visually confirm the emitter is pointing at the receiver (not at the ground, not at the post, not at a shrub), and the receiver LED is solid, alignment is fine. No further adjustment needed.

The Burbank-specific problem: Ground movement. Burbank’s clay soil expands and contracts significantly with moisture changes. Photo-eye posts, if mounted on separate posts or on a post that’s settling, shift relative to each other. That’s why the same gate that worked fine in May misaligns in November after the first rains. Check alignment quarterly, and after any significant rain event.

Warning: if the photo-eye is aligned correctly and the gate still reverses mid-cycle, do not bypass the photo-eye to “fix” the problem. That’s not a fix. That’s disabling a safety system. The problem is likely a wiring fault, a failing photo-eye, or an obstruction detection setting. Call a technician.

Burbank Seasonal Maintenance: Santa Ana Winds and Summer Heat

Burbank has two maintenance seasons, and neither of them matches the generic “spring and fall” advice you’ll find in most gate checklists. Here’s what actually matters in this specific climate.

October through December (Santa Ana season): Santa Ana winds produce sustained 30 to 50 mph gusts with relative humidity dropping into the single digits. Two things happen to your gate. First, the wind pushes directly against a closed gate, cycling the hinges and stressing the operator’s hold circuit. Second, fine dust and sand get blown into every moving part, especially chain links, wheel bearings, and limit switch housings. After every Santa Ana event, do a visual inspection for debris in the track and re-grease the chain. If you have a slide gate with a chain, the dry air actually reduces chain corrosion, but it accelerates abrasive wear from the dust.

One more Santa Ana consideration: bungee cords and propped-open gates. During high-wind events, some homeowners prop their gates open to prevent wind damage. We understand the instinct. But an open gate during a windstorm is a sail. The wind catches the gate face and slams it against the end stop, bending the gate frame and damaging the operator gearbox. If you must prop the gate open, use a solid mechanical stop on both sides, and unplug the operator first. Better yet, upgrade to a wind-rated operator with a clutch that releases under excessive force.

June through September (summer heat): Burbank regularly sees 90°F to 100°F days in July and August, and interior temperatures inside a metal operator housing can reach 140°F. Heat affects hydraulic operators the most. Hydraulic fluid thins as temperature rises, reducing the operator’s effective force. If your gate is sluggish in the summer but fine in the winter, the hydraulic fluid may be the wrong viscosity or overdue for replacement. FAAC and BFT hydraulic operators, which are common on Burbank swing gates, should have their fluid checked every two years.

Summer is also when the insects show up. Spider webs and mud wasp nests inside operator housings and photo-eye lenses are a real thing. A spider web across a photo-eye lens is enough to diffuse the beam and trigger a false obstruction detection. Check photo-eye lenses monthly in summer.

The Maintenance Log: How to Document Every Check So It’s Useful Later

Here’s the part that every other maintenance checklist skips: the record. A checklist you fill out and throw away is worthless. A maintenance log you keep for five years becomes the most valuable document attached to your gate. When you sell the house, it’s evidence that the gate was maintained. When something breaks, it tells the technician what was done, what was replaced, and what readings were normal last month.

What to record in your gate maintenance log:

  • Date and time of the inspection.
  • Chain or belt measurement (the actual number, not “looks fine”).
  • Hinge play measurement in millimeters.
  • Battery float voltage reading.
  • Photo-eye LED status (solid or blinking, before and after adjustment).
  • Parts replaced, including brand, part number, and source.
  • Photos of any wear you observed, taken from the same angle each time so you can compare over time.
  • Technician name and company if a professional did the work.

The reason we document this heavily is simple: your next technician, whether it’s us or someone else, should never have to guess what was done before.

On the subject of replacements: if your maintenance log shows three hinge replacements in five years, you have a systemic issue, not a hinge issue. That log is what tells us the real problem is likely the gate post or the gate weight distribution. Without the log, we’d replace the hinge and send you on your way. With the log, we fix the root cause.

What You Can Do Yourself vs. What Requires a Technician

This is the section most guides get wrong. They either tell you everything is DIY or nothing is. Here’s the honest breakdown for Burbank homeowners, based on California electrical code and basic safety.

Safe to DIY (with power off and gate secured):

  • Visual inspection of track, chain, belt, hinges, and photo-eyes.
  • Clearing debris from tracks and photo-eye lenses with a soft brush.
  • Greasing accessible chain and hinges with the correct lubricant.
  • Measuring chain elongation and hinge play.
  • Checking battery voltage with a multimeter (leads only on the battery terminals).
  • Photographing everything and updating your maintenance log.

Requires a licensed technician:

  • Opening the operator housing for any reason. Capacitors inside store lethal voltage.
  • Adjusting limit switches. These control how far the gate travels and setting them wrong can damage the gate or the operator.
  • Any work on the control board, wiring, or capacitor.
  • Hydraulic fluid inspection or replacement.
  • Spring tension adjustment on any gate with an assist spring. Gate springs are under enormous tension and release instantly if mishandled.
  • Replacing wheel bearings or hinge pins, if the gate must be supported and partially disassembled.

The line between DIY and professional work isn’t about how handy you are. It’s about whether a mistake injures someone or creates an unsafe condition. We’ve seen Burbank homeowners successfully maintain their gates for years with nothing more than a multimeter, a tape measure, and a maintenance log. We’ve also seen a homeowner in the Riverside Drive area lose the tip of a finger to a gate hinge that slipped during a DIY replacement because the gate wasn’t supported. The checklist above keeps you on the right side of that line.

Common Mistakes to Avoid

  • Lubricating without cleaning first. Grease on top of sand and metal shavings creates an abrasive paste that accelerates wear. Clean the chain with a dry brush, then lubricate. Lube over debris is worse than no lube at all.
  • Using WD-40 on chains and hinges. WD-40 is a solvent, not a lubricant. It displaces water (good) and strips existing grease (bad). Use a proper chain lube or lithium grease. We see WD-40-dried chains on Burbank gates all the time, usually accompanied by a rusty chain that needs replacement.
  • Ignoring a gate that’s slightly slower than it used to be. A gate that takes 20 seconds to open instead of 15 is telling you something. Slow speed means resistance, resistance means friction, friction means wear somewhere. Find the resistance before it finds you.
  • Bypassing the photo-eye. If the gate won’t close because the photo-eye is “acting up,” bypassing it is the single most dangerous thing you can do. The photo-eye is what stops the gate from crushing a child, a pet, or a delivery driver. Fix the photo-eye, don’t disable it.
  • Pressure washing the operator. Water and electronics don’t mix. Pressure washing drives water into the housing, the limit switch, the control board. The corrosion doesn’t show up immediately; it shows up six months later as an intermittent fault that’s expensive to diagnose.
  • Not photographing before and after. Your eyes are not a reliable record. Photos taken from the same angle every time are. If you’re not photographing your maintenance, you’re not maintaining, you’re just looking.
  • Ignoring the gate post. The post is the foundation of the entire system. A post that’s leaning 5 degrees stresses every other component on the gate. In Burbank’s clay soil, post settlement is common. Check it monthly. Fix it when it moves.

When to Call a Professional

Call a professional when you see any of these: a chain measurement over 3% elongation, hinge play over 2mm, battery float voltage below 12.4V at rest, a photo-eye LED that won’t stay solid after realignment, a gate that’s visibly leaning, or any electrical symptom you can’t fully explain. These aren’t minor issues. They’re early warnings of failures that get more expensive the longer they go unaddressed. The Bottom Line

Gate maintenance in Burbank is not complicated, but it is specific. The difference between a gate that lasts 15 years and a gate that fails in 7 is not luck. It’s measurement: chain elongation, hinge play, float voltage, photo-eye alignment. It’s the maintenance log that turns your observations into a service history. And it’s knowing which tasks are yours and which belong to a licensed technician.
